The term "Byzantine" is an historiographical exonym: the people in the empire continually self-identified as "Romans" and referred to … el kanji es chino o japonesWebOttoman Empire, Former empire centred in Anatolia. The Ottoman Empire was named for Osman I (1259–1326), a Turkish Muslim prince in Bithynia who conquered neighbouring regions once held by the Seljūq dynasty and founded his own ruling line c. 1300.
